1883 Variety 9






Obverse 14

Reverse N



Obverse Diagnostics



Date Position

Base Of A Misplaced 8 Digit

Defect At Top and Broken Base Of 3


Obverse 14 is identified by date placement at C and the base of a misplaced 8 digit located below the portrait and to the left of the ribbon end.  Obverse 14 is observed with the 3 of the date exhibiting a defect at the top and a broken base.
.
Reverse N has developed the following die crack:
1.  Die crack from the rim at 10:15 extends downward through the left wreath.

Comments:  Though the Obverse 14 misplaced digit was initially identified as a 3 for the Snow 9 Die Pairing, I suspect the misplaced digit is an 8.
